#f10714 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f10714 is composed of 94.5% red, 2.7%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.1%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 356.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 48.6%. #f10714 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0e28 with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

#f10714 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f10714 has RGB values of R:241, G:7,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.92,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15795988.

Shades and Tints of #f10714
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0001 is the darkest color, while #fff8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f10714
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f797a is the less saturated color, while #f10714 is the most saturated one.
